Level Up Boxing VR, released in 2023, brings an exhilarating twist to the world of virtual reality gaming. This action-packed sports title invites players to step into the ring and engage in immersive boxing matches where skill and strategy are paramount. Its notable charm lies in the engaging mechanics that make players feel like true champions while delivering a casual gaming experience that can be enjoyed by everyone.
When it comes to PC performance, Level Up Boxing VR is designed to be accessible to a wide range of gamers. With a minimum GPU requirement of an entry-level model scoring around 8150 and a CPU score of approximately 4064, players can expect decent performance even on budget systems. Those looking to maximize their FPS should consider mid-tier GPUs for improved graphics settings and smoother gameplay, providing a better virtual boxing experience without overwhelming hardware demands.
